Trollinger Law LLC Named 2025 Best Law Firm in Southern Maryland Through Community Voting

Trollinger Law today announced its selection as the 2025 Best Law Firm in Southern Maryland through an annual competition hosted by the Southern Maryland News that allows community members to vote for their favorite businesses and organizations. Firm founder Matthew D. Trollinger expressed gratitude for the recognition, noting that while many legal associations rate attorneys for their work, feedback from neighbors and clients provides meaningful insight into the firm's real impact on people's lives.

This community-based honor comes during a period of significant achievement for the firm. Trollinger Law LLC recently earned a spot on the prestigious Inc. 5000 list of fastest-growing private law firms, coinciding with the opening of another office in La Plata. Additionally, Matthew Trollinger was named a member of the Nation's Top One Percent by the National Association of Distinguished Counsel for 2025, an honor reserved for attorneys demonstrating the highest standards of legal excellence.

The firm's community engagement extends beyond its legal services through initiatives like the annual Hometown Heroes competition, which celebrates local first responders for their dedicated service to others. This year's winners received recognition at Blue Crabs and DC United games, further strengthening the firm's ties to the Southern Maryland community. The firm serves clients throughout Southern Maryland and Washington, D.C., representing injured people in workers' compensation and personal injury claims including cases involving car accidents, commercial truck accidents, bicycle accidents, pedestrian accidents, construction accidents, premises liability, slip and falls, medical malpractice, traumatic brain injury, burns, and wrongful death.
